1. Recommended Cuisines and Restaurants:
a. Tex-Mex Delights at El Tiempo Cantina: Offering an authentic Tex-Mex experience, El Tiempo Cantina is a local favorite on West 20th Street. Diners rave about their sizzling fajitas, mouthwatering enchiladas, and refreshing margaritas.
b. Italian Comfort at Coltivare: Known for its cozy ambiance and farm-to-table concept, Coltivare serves up delectable Italian-inspired dishes. From wood-fired pizzas to homemade pastas, this restaurant receives high praise for its quality ingredients and rustic flavors.
c. Fresh Seafood at Liberty Kitchen & Oysterette: Seafood lovers flock to Liberty Kitchen & Oysterette for its extensive raw bar offerings and Gulf Coast-inspired cuisine. This vibrant eatery is renowned for serving up succulent oysters, mouthwatering lobster rolls, and refreshing cocktails.
2. Local Favorites vs. Tourist Hotspots:
a. Local Favorites - Onion Creek: A beloved hangout spot for locals, Onion Creek offers a relaxed atmosphere, live music, and a wide selection of craft beers. Their menu features American comfort food with a Southern twist, including juicy burgers, appetizing sandwiches, and flavorful salads.
b. Tourist Hotspot - Down House: Known for its trendy aesthetics and creative menu offerings, Down House attracts tourists seeking an Instagram-worthy dining experience. The restaurant specializes in contemporary American cuisine, serving up dishes like smoked salmon benedict and brioche French toast.
3. Pricing Spectrum:
West 20th Street boasts a range of dining options to suit various budgets:
a. Budget-Friendly: Local favorites such as Onion Creek and El Tiempo Cantina offer reasonably priced menus, with entrees ranging from $10 to $20.
b. Mid-Range: Coltivare and Liberty Kitchen & Oysterette fall into the mid-range category, with main courses averaging between $15 and $30.
c. Upscale: For those seeking a more lavish experience, Down House offers high-end dining with entrees typically priced between $25 and $40.
